Sure they can a 7x 7.75 offer is equal to 6 x8 in take home pay

Nah, you're forgetting the signing bonus taxation fuckery that Tavares got caught up in (Tavares ended up winning, so is now precedent) exists.

So if the deal is front loaded and heavy in 1st year signing bonuses, they are not equal offers. With the benefit of the 7 yr offer leaving a better opportunity of a late career 2-4 yr deal if he's still good. He'll be 37 at the end of that deal. So maybe/probably cooked by then, but that 8th year would have value to him in negotiations now. He and his agent aren't just going to assume that it's a dead year that can be used for free by Tampa to keep his AAV cheaper.

He can maintain his "permanent" residence as a tax entity in Florida, there is an additional tax benefit on "jock tax" games played outside of Canada. That's likely another 100-200K a year in tax home pay as well on the side of the 7.75 x 7

If Tampa wanted to match Toronto offering the AFP suggested 8.05 million at 7 years (to combat the 8 year theoretical offer here that is super fucking unlikely Tampa would consider making...there's a reason they started at 5 yrs in talks), and Toronto offered the deal in the most tax advantageous way they can (Which would be approx 10.5 millie in the first season, 9.5 of that in signing bonus taxed at a far lower rate, saving him about 4 million in taxes on that alone)...Tampa would have to be somewhere in the range of 6.7 million x 8 to match the total value of the 8.05 x 7...which is of course, from Raddysh's standpoint, giving Tampa a year of his career for free just so they they can save money.

The more likely fight here is what Tampa would have to do if they wanted to match Raddysh's take home pay on a deal in the range of the AFP 8.05 x 6 deal if it was offered by the Leafs. That number, dependent on various types of accounting fuckery, is about 7.5 million in this specific instance.
